TRANSFER-FUNCTION CONDITIONS FOR STABILIZABILITY Academic Article uri icon

abstract

  • For the linear time invariant system a necessary and sufficient condition based on the proper rational transfer function matrices {G, H, M, N} is given for the existence of a proper stabilizing controller uc(s) = C(s).ym(s). The condition states that the McMillan degrees of M+(s) and must be equal, wher G(s), H+(s), M+(s), N(s) represents the unstable components of the partial fraction expansions of {G(s), H(s), M(s), N(s)}.
